Transaction ed94b015576af2403325a9bcae3761f8588f33f7fd014747baa148522ac36128
1 Input
2 Outputs
- ed94b015576af2403325a9bcae3761f8588f33f7fd014747baa148522ac36128:0
- ed94b015576af2403325a9bcae3761f8588f33f7fd014747baa148522ac36128:1
value 1000000
address mpNjD4MnHyJb2L4t1QzEgPhWyEEM9YkuEq
value 97952917
address muJaUc6ZVzb2CUeDaUAMLkjpfDbL4SLka5